Block stock sinks after third quarter results miss estimates

Block shares fell 10% Friday after weak third-quarter earnings fell short of Wall Street expectations and showed slowing profit growth for the company’s Square service. Here is how the company did compared with LSEG estimates: Earnings per share: 54 cents adjusted vs. 67 cents expected Revenue: $6.11 billion vs. $6.31 billion expected The Jack Dorsey-founded firm’s shares…
